Factors that Affect Solar Panel Costs in Trotwood

There are a number of criteria that can play into your solar panel installation cost, such as the size of your system, the equipment you choose, your financing options and the specific company that installs your solar system.

Solar Equipment

Solar system size, which is measured in kilowatts, is one of the largest factors that influences the overall cost of installing solar panels. Because of that, it’s important to accurately gauge the size of the solar energy system needed for your home by figuring out your energy needs.The kind of solar equipment you choose can increase or decrease your cost by thousands or even tens of thousands of dollars. If you get the most efficient solar panel brands, you’ll end up paying more upfront than if you opted for the most affordable panels. On the other hand, higher efficiency could save you more over time on your electric bills. In addition, add-on products, like solar batteries, can bump up your total well above the Trotwood average.

Solar Financing Terms

If paying for a solar system out of pocket is out of reach, solar loans are a popular choice because they cut back your upfront costs and allow you to pay for your system over a term of, on average, between five and seven years.It’s wise to include the interest you’ll pay in your final cost estimate. If you can afford to put more money down upfront, you can reduce your total costs and the amount of time it’ll take to pay off the loan.

Solar Panel Installation Company

The last key cost factor you should keep in mind is the installer you choose. Given the booming popularity of sustainable energy solutions in Trotwood, you’ll have many options to choose from, but each comes at varying price points for labor and equipment.Companies that only sell high-quality, high-efficiency and high-price products — like Maxeon solar panels from SunPower or Tesla Powerwall batteries — so choosing those installers will generally come at a higher cost. It’s best to do some research and find a company that has the products, warranties and services you’re looking for and also fits within your budget.

How to Save on Solar Panels

The company that does your system installation will affect the warranties and brands you have access to, and it will also have an impact on your total cost. Since choosing a company can be a tough decision, we have some tips to help you, such as:

  • Installation Process: An important thing to understand when adopting solar energy is the installation process itself. Be sure to clarify any details you should know with your solar installer, such as what permits you should secure and what the project timeline is.
  • Contract: Before signing a contract with a solar installer, make sure you look it over carefully so you understand the terms. Also, ask questions if you’re not sure about some of the terms, such as what to do if a component breaks or malfunctions and what services you can expect from them.
  • Solar Panel Brands: Not all solar companies offer the same brands of solar panels, so the brand and type of panel you want can play a significant role in the company you choose.
  • Warranty: Each company may offer different kinds of warranties that provide different kinds of coverage. A 25-year, all-inclusive warranty is the gold standard.

Do solar panels increase your property value?

Solar panels can increase the value of your property by about 4%, according to research done by Zillow. The average home value in Trotwood is currently $115,146, which means you can look forward to a value of about $4,721 more than houses without a solar system. The specific figures will vary, but most experts agree that installing solar panels in Trotwood is a fruitful investment.

How long do solar panels last in Trotwood?

On average, the lifespan of solar panels is about 25 to 30 years. Some even last up to 50 years, but their efficiency goes down by about 0.8% each year. You can choose to replace them sooner if you want to maintain a larger level of energy production.
